Webber: Great camaraderie with Vettel

Mark Webber says he shares a "great camaraderie" with Sebastian Vettel despite what happened in the Malaysian Grand Prix. The relationship between the two took a serious knock at the Sepang circuit when Vettel deliberately disobeyed team orders to take the victory from Webber. It was not the first incident in the duo's relationship and most likely will not be the last as Vettel made it clear that if the situation ever arose he would do it again. But despite that, Webber says he has a good relationship with his triple World Champion team-mate.
